  1. Aug 17, 2018 · What are the levels of culture? Hammond divides culture into three levels: Surface culture is observable and concrete elements of culture such as food, dress, music, and holidays. Low emotional charge. Changes do not create great anxiety.

  2. Apr 7, 2022 · Iceberg Model of Culture. " Iceberg Model of Culture ," established by Edward T Hall in 1976, describes how organizational culture is like an iceberg found in the cold waters of the Arctic. Only 10% of an iceberg is visible above water, while the rest is submerged under it; this is known as the "iceberg effect."
